திருக்குறள் -TIRUKKURAL
அதிகாரம் 91 - பெண்வழிச் சேறல்
CHAPTER 91 - FOLLOWING WOMAN'S ADVICE
***
91/01. மனைவிழைவார் மாண்பயன் எய்தார்; வினைவிழைவார்
வேண்டாப் பொருளும் அது.

91/01. Manaivizhaivaar maannpayan eaidhaar; vinaivizhaivaar
Vendaap porullum adhu.

91/01. One who listens to the advices of his wife for the sake of her love, he'll not get rich benefits in his life. This is not in his interest when he loves his work.

91/02. பேணாது பெண்விழைவான் ஆக்கம் பெரியதோர்
நாணாக நாணுத் தரும்

91/02. Pennaadhu pennvizhaivaan aakkam periyadhoar
Naannaagha naannuth tharum.

91/02. If one without thinking himself, does whatever wife says
His life will be shameful, by keeping his head down.

91/03. இல்லாள்கண் தாழ்ந்த இயல்பின்மை எஞ்ஞான்றும்
நல்லாருள் நாணுத் தரும்.

91/03. Ilaallkann thaazhndha iyalbinmai egngnaandrum
Nallaarull naannuth tharum.

91/03. If one is the most obedient husband to his wife,
He'll be feeling delicate to face good people outside.
